ISSPACE(3) OpenBSD Programmer's Manual ISSPACE(3)NAME
isspace - whitespace character test
SYNOPSIS
#include <ctype.h>
int
isspace(int c);
DESCRIPTION
The isspace() function tests for the standard whitespace characters for
which isalnum(3) is false. The standard whitespace characters are the
following:
` ' Space character.
\f Form feed.
\n New-line.
\r Carriage return.
\t Horizontal tab.
\v And vertical tab.
In the C locale, isspace() returns true only for the standard whitespace
characters.
RETURN VALUES
The isspace() macro returns zero if the character tests false or non-zero
if the character tests true.

The isspace() function conforms to ANSI X3.159-1989 (``ANSI C'').
CAVEATS
The argument to isspace() must be EOF or representable as an unsigned
char; otherwise, the result is undefined.
